Section 40-9-115 - Demand for person held on charge of crime in Tennessee

Ask AI about this
If a criminal prosecution has been instituted against the person under the laws of this state and is still pending, the governor, at the governor's discretion, either may surrender the person on the demand of the executive authority of another state, or may hold the person until the person has been tried and discharged, or convicted and punished in this state.Acts 1951, ch. 240, § 19 (Williams, § 11935.19); T.C.A. (orig. ed.), § 40-1015.
